What is Vetsulin?

Vetsulin (porcine insulin zinc suspension) is indicated for the reduction of hyperglycemia in cats and dogs with diabetes mellitus. It also helps reduce the associated clinical signs of hyperglycemia in cats and dogs. Vetsulin is a sterile aqueous zinc suspension of purified porcine insulin that is injectable.

Why use Vetsulin?

Vetsulin is the first and only FDA-approved insulin available in the USA for use in Diabetes in Dogs and Cats.

What are Possible Vetsulin Side Effects?

The most common Vetsulin insulin-related side effect is low blood sugar (hypoglycemia) with symptoms that include; lethargy, staggering gait, seizure, or coma. Allergic reactions are rare and symptoms include; difficult breathing, hives, scratching, swollen lips, tongue, eyelids, earflaps, sudden onset of diarrhea, vomiting, shock, seizures, pale gums, cold limbs, or coma. Contact your Veterinarian immediately if your dog or cat has a medical problem or side effect from Vetsulin therapy.

How do I store Vetsulin?

Store Vetsulin in an upright position under refrigeration at 2° to 8° C (36° to 46° F). Do not freeze. Protect from light. Use contents within 42 days of first vial puncture.

Contraindications of Vetsulin: Dogs and Cats known to have systemic allergy to pork or pork products should not be treated with Vetsulin. Vetsulin is contraindicated during periods of hypoglycemia.
